Air duct securing is the process of discovering any kind of leaks or cracks in your ductwork and after that fixing them (https://doodleordie.com/profile/uheatingaair). Various products can be utilized to seal ducts from both the within and outdoors. This procedure can enhance the efficiency of your heating and cooling system, but it can likewise shield your interior air top quality
It can be made use of on small hairline cracks in your ductwork. They treat to create a really strong seal that maintains conditioned air in and pollutants out.
